Obtain contig information

Using the input fields below you can access information in several different ways:

1) Enter a SNP name (a 10 character alphanumeric beginning with 'BS' or 'BA'; e.g., BS00010624 or BA0033400) to find the contig to which it maps and all other putative SNPs, validated or not, that have been mapped to it. SNP names (IDs) may take different forms depending on the platform on which the assay was developed:

KASP assays BS00003643
Axiom array BA00334300

SNP names with 'BS' codes may have an extention (e.g., '.1', '.2'. These should not be added when performing a search; if they are added they will be removed by the program before the search is performed.


2) Enter a contig name (e.g., contig98294) in order to find the SNP(s) that map to it.

3) Enter a search term (e.g., disease) in order to obtain a list of contigs that when BLASTed against the NCBI database returned a hit containing the chosen term.
